Farmer's Select Nicaraguan Habano
Habano wrappers are commonly linked to balanced, structured smoke. Farmer's Select Nicaraguan Habano comes from Nicaragua at medium strength. Lengths run from 5.0 to 6.0 inches with ring gauges from 50 to 60 across 3 sizes. It is priced under $5. Nicaraguan cigars are often associated with fuller-bodied blending traditions. Spec sheet
Vitolas
3 formats in the catalog.
| Shape | Length | Ring gauge |
|---|---|---|
| Robusto | 5" | 50 |
| Toro | 6" | 50 |
| Gordo | 6" | 60 |
